2021 AZN to IQD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2021

During 2021, the AZN to IQD ex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on May 10, valuing the pair at 864.1851.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on May 8, dropping to 851.3662.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 12.8189 IQD.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 859.6264 to the December average rate of 858.6227, the exchange rate registered a net change of -0.12%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2021 high of 864.1851 was up 0.65% compared to the 2020 peak of 858.5945,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

AZN to IQD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is

A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: JanтАУJun) was 858.8139, compared to 858.1465 in the second half (H2: JulтАУDec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(JanтАУJun) by a margin of 0.6674 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

The most volatile month in 2021 was May, with a trading range of 12.8189 IQD (High: 864.1851 / Low: 851.3662). On the other end, September was the most stable month, with a tight range of 1.2278 IQD (High: 858.8286 / Low: 857.6008).
